via Science News Relative temperature and salinity variations within seawater of the same density. Warmer, saltier ocean water is considered spicy while cooler, fresher water is minty. Climate change will spice up the Arctic Ocean, researchers report in the April Journal of Physical Oceanography. Seawater that is both salty and cold is the most dense, and therefore sits deep in the ocean.
